深度ASP教程:开启你的Web开发探索之旅
ASP(Active Server Pages)是一种由微软开发的服务器端脚本环境,用于创建动态网页和Web应用程序。在这个深度ASP教程中,我们将一起启航Web开发之旅,探索ASP的基础知识、核心概念以及实践应用。 ASP允许开发者在HTML页面中嵌入VBScript或JScript代码。当服务器接收到一个ASP页面的请求时,它会执行页面中的脚本,并将结果以HTML的形式返回给客户端浏览器。这种机制使得ASP成为创建交互式Web应用的理想选择。 ASP页面的文件扩展名通常为.asp。在编写ASP代码时,你可以使用特殊的ASP标签来包裹脚本代码。例如,使用标签来定义VBScript或JScript代码块。ASP还提供了一系列内置对象,如Request、Response、Session和Application,这些对象简化了与客户端的交互、管理会话状态以及应用程序级别的数据存储。 要运行ASP代码,你需要一个支持ASP的Web服务器,如IIS(Internet Information Services)。IIS是微软提供的Web服务器软件,它内置了对ASP的支持。安装IIS后,你可以将ASP页面放置在指定的Web站点目录中,并通过浏览器访问这些页面来查看执行结果。 在ASP开发中,数据库连接是一个重要的环节。ASP提供了ADO(ActiveX Data Objects)来简化数据库访问。通过ADO,你可以连接到各种数据库(如Microsoft Access、SQL Server等),执行SQL查询,并处理查询结果。ADO对象模型包括Connection、Command和Recordset等对象,它们分别用于建立数据库连接、执行命令以及处理数据集。 随着Web技术的不断发展,ASP逐渐被更先进的Web开发框架和技术所取代,如ASP.NET。然而,对于初学者来说,学习ASP仍然是一个有价值的起点。通过掌握ASP的基础知识,你可以更好地理解Web开发的基本原理和概念,为后续学习更高级的技术打下坚实的基础。 AI生成结论图,仅供参考 在这个深度ASP教程的结尾,我们鼓励你动手实践。尝试编写一些简单的ASP页面,使用内置对象处理用户输入,连接到数据库并执行查询。通过实践,你将更深入地理解ASP的工作原理,并开启你的Web开发之旅。(编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|